Wolves ending up with Wallace would be anti-climactic

Wolverhampton Wanderers’ next most likely signing will be Lazio defender Wallace according to The Daily Mail.

The Black Country club have been linked with the Brazilian over the past few days, and could secure him for £6.5 million according to La Lazio Siamo Noi.

Wolves have already signed Jesus Vallejo on loan from Real Madrid, but arguably need another new face with Europa League football to contend with.

The towering centre-half has been deemed surplus to requirements by the Italian outfit, and there is hope on the part of both clubs he can complete a move to Molineux before the deadline.

Although a capable defender, Wallace is not necessarily an upgrade on any of Nuno Espirito Santo’s current options.

One man who would have been though, is Ruben Dias.

Portugal international Dias will remain at Benfica for another season according to A Bola, having recently been linked with a move to Wolves.

He would have been an unbelievable signing, which renders the potential incoming of Wallace somewhat underwhelming.

Dias would have been much more expensive and perhaps quite unlikely (he supposedly has a €66 million/£60 million release clause – The Sun), but news of him remaining at Benfica still makes a move for Wallace feel like a bit of an anti-climax given the difference in ability.
